Overnight Breakfast Casserole Recipe
Ingredients:
- 6 slices bread, cubed (French, sourdough, or whole wheat)
- 1 lb breakfast sausage (or bacon/ham), cooked & crumbled
- 1 ½ cups shredded cheese (cheddar, mozzarella, or Swiss)
- 6 large eggs
- 2 cups milk
- ½ tsp salt
- ½ tsp black pepper
- ½ tsp garlic powder (optional)
- ½ tsp onion powder (optional)
- 1 tsp Dijon mustard (adds depth of flavor)
- Chopped green onions or parsley (for garnish)
Instructions:
- Grease a 9×13-inch baking dish.
- Layer the bread cubes evenly in the dish.
- Sprinkle cooked sausage (or bacon/ham) over the bread.
- Add shredded cheese on top.
- Whisk eggs, milk, salt, pepper, garlic powder, onion powder, and mustard in a large bowl.
- Pour the egg mixture evenly over the casserole.
- Cover and refrigerate overnight (or at least 4 hours) to soak up flavors.
Baking Instructions:
-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).
- Remove casserole from fridge and let it sit at room temp for 15 minutes.
- Bake uncovered for 40-45 minutes, until golden brown and set in the center.
- Let it rest for 5 minutes, then garnish with green onions or parsley.
Serving Ideas & Variations:
🫑 Veggie Version – Add bell peppers, mushrooms, or spinach.
🌶 Spicy Kick – Add jalapeños or red pepper flakes.
🥑 Low-Carb Option – Swap bread for cauliflower or keto bread.
